For nearly a century, the Nittany Lion Inn has been a cherished gathering place at Penn State University, welcoming alumni, students, and visitors alike. Whether for milestone celebrations, game day traditions, or a quiet retreat in the heart of campus, the inn has long been an integral part of the Happy Valley experience. Now, after a thoughtful transformation, the Nittany Lion Inn reopens its doors, blending historic charm with a fresh, modern approach.

Bellefonte’s Harmony Forge Inn, a hidden gem tucked along the tranquil banks of Spring Creek, has entered a new chapter under the ownership of Kasey Rhoa and her family. With a rich history and stunning Victorian charm, this beloved inn is poised for exciting changes that travelers to the region won’t want to miss.
